2 definitions found From The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48 [gcide]: Clingstone \Cling"stone`\, a. Having the flesh attached closely to the stone, as in some kinds of peaches. -- n. A fruit, as a peach, whose flesh adheres to the stone. [1913 Webster] From WordNet (r) 2.0 [wn]: clingstone n : fruit (especially peach) whose flesh adheres strongly to the pit [syn: {cling}]
